    In his recent interview, Freddie Roach, Manny Pacquiao’s trainer since the start of the Filipino’s career, said that he has spoken to his fighter about retirement. According to Roach, Manny Pacquiao is keen on following his trainer’s advice because he knows ‘trainers know best’.
    Roach said, “The thing is, we’ve talked about that (retirement). Manny’s asked me ‘When I start showing signs of slippage and I need to retire, will you tell me?’ and I said ‘I’ll be the first one to tell you’ Manny. And I said ‘When I tell you, will you retire?’ and he (Pacquiao) said ‘Of course I will. Because most guys won’t (contemplate retirement when needed). We have a good relationship and I know he’s coming close to the end of his career.”
    It should be noted here that Roach has been Pacquiao’s trainer for more than 10 years now. It is because of Roach that Pacquiao has been able to understand his real strength and skills. Recently, Pacquiao spoke about his retirement. He said that he will retire probably after his fight with Timothy Bradley, but his family is insisting him to fight Floyd Mayweather Jr. before he hangs up his gloves. Some days later, Pacquiao changed his retirement plans and is now looking forward to beat Floyd.
